The Hardt 9012 Light Socket Ceramic #3152 is a high-performance electrical component designed for industrial lighting applications. Manufactured by Hardt under the OEM category, this ceramic socket is engineered for durability and reliable conductivity in demanding environments. Its precise dimensions—1.3 inches high and 1.3 inches wide—ensure seamless integration into luminaires and fixture assemblies. The socket’s robust ceramic construction provides excellent thermal resistance, preventing heat buildup and extending operational lifespan, making it suitable for commercial lighting systems and specialized machinery that require consistent electrical connections. With a weight of only 0.11 lbs, it offers ease of installation while maintaining structural integrity during prolonged use.

What is a commercial light socket ceramic
A commercial light socket ceramic is a high-temperature-resistant electrical component used to securely hold and connect light bulbs within industrial and foodservice lighting fixtures.
